Foolproof Tips on How to Check a Criminal Record in Canada

A criminal record is a record of an individual’s criminal convictions. Criminal records are maintained by the government and can be used for a variety of purposes, such as employment screening, housing applications, and immigration proceedings. In Canada, there are two main types of criminal records: summary conviction records and indictable conviction records. Summary conviction records are for less serious offences, such as speeding or theft under $5,000. Indictable conviction records are for more serious offences, such as robbery or murder.

There are a number of reasons why you might need to check your criminal record. For example, you may need to provide a criminal record check to a potential employer or landlord. You may also need to check your criminal record if you are planning to travel to another country. In some cases, you may be able to obtain a copy of your criminal record for free. However, there is usually a fee associated with obtaining a criminal record check.

Comprehensive Guide to Appealing a Criminal Conviction

An appeal is a request to a higher court to review a decision made by a lower court. The process of appealing a criminal conviction can be complex, and it is important to have the assistance of an experienced attorney. There are several different grounds for appealing a criminal conviction, including errors of law, errors of fact, and ineffective assistance of counsel. In order to be successful, an appeal must be filed within a specific time frame and must comply with certain procedural requirements.Appealing a criminal conviction can be a long and challenging process, but it can also be successful. If you have been convicted of a crime, you should speak to an attorney to discuss your options for appealing your conviction.

There are many benefits to appealing a criminal conviction. If you are successful, you could have your conviction overturned or your sentence reduced. You could even be granted a new trial. Appealing a criminal conviction can also help to set legal precedent and improve the criminal justice system.

Ultimate Guide to Appealing a Criminal Case: Expert Tips and Strategies

An appeal is a request to a higher court to review a decision made by a lower court. In a criminal case, an appeal can be filed by the defendant or by the prosecution. The defendant can appeal a conviction or sentence, while the prosecution can appeal a dismissal or acquittal. An appeal is not a new trial, but rather a review of the lower court’s decision to determine if there were any errors that affected the outcome of the case.

Appeals are important because they ensure that the criminal justice system is fair and accurate. They allow defendants to challenge convictions or sentences that they believe are unjust, and they allow the prosecution to challenge dismissals or acquittals that they believe are incorrect. Appeals also help to ensure that the law is applied consistently across different jurisdictions.
